Sherry is in her mid-eighties and is moving to a nursing home. She is used to getting up at 5 o'clock each morning and making br

eakfast for herself. Her new roommate likes to sleep until 7 o'clock and breakfast is not served at the nursing home until 8 o'clock. What is Sherry most likely to experience through this transition?a. A shift in her desire to enjoy life.b. A shift in her reading habits.c. Resocialization.d. A complete and permanent loss of herself.
Social Studies
1 answer:
Zarrin [17]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Sherry will experience C. Resocialization.

Explanation:

Resocialization means having one's aspects in life re-engineered. An individual who was used to a certain lifestyle must adhere to a new set of norms.

For example; Sherry has to reintegrate into the new community; whereas her routine of getting up at 5 o'clock to make herself breakfast will no longer be plausible, since someone will do it for her at a later hour.

In classical conditioning, what is the unlearned, naturally occurring response to the unconditioned stimulus (US), such as saliv
ludmilkaskok [199]

Answer:

The answer unconditioned response.

Explanation:

Unconditioned response is a natural reaction we show when presented with an unconditioned stimulus. It is an automatic, unlearned response, a reflex. Salivation, as mentioned in the question, is a natural response from our body when we have food in out mouth. Another example of unconditioned response would be jumping or screaming when someone scares us.
